🔥 Burning Instructions
General Burning Instructions
- Prepare the surface: Make sure it is clean, dry, and free of oils.
- Test first: Always test your heat on a hidden area or scrap material.
- Transfer the design: Use graphite paper and secure it so it does not shift.
- Stabilize your work: Keep the surface firm and supported while burning.
- Burn lightly: Start with outlines and build darkness with light passes.
- Finish carefully: Allow to cool fully and brush away residue.
Product-Specific Tips
Baseball Caps: Insert a firm support (towel or cardboard) inside the crown to prevent dents.

🧰 Recommended Tools
Basic Tools (Recommended for Most Projects)
- Burning tool: Wood burning pen with adjustable temperature (or a basic solid-tip burner)
- Practice material: Scrap felt/leather/wood to test heat and strokes
- Graphite or carbon paper: For transferring the design
- Tape: Painter’s tape to keep the design from shifting
- Ruler / measuring tape: For centering and alignment
- Pencil / stylus: For tracing the design
- Small brush or lint roller: To remove residue and dust
- Heat-safe work surface: Ceramic tile, metal tray, or silicone mat
Helpful Extras
- Fine-tip points: For thin lines and detailed work
- Shader tip: For smooth shading and gradients
- Ventilation: Small fan or open window (recommended)
- Protective gloves: Optional for heat safety
Baseball Cap Add-Ons
- Hat insert / support: Cardboard, towel, or hat form to prevent dents
- Clips (optional): To hold the panel steady while you work
Tip: Always test heat settings on a hidden area or scrap material first.
